#4bb30e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4bb30e is composed of 29.4% red, 70.2%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 92.2%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 97.8 degrees, a saturation of 85.5% and a lightness of 37.8%. #4bb30e color hex could be obtained by blending #96ff1c with #006700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

Shades and Tints of #4bb30e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060f01 is the darkest color, while #fdf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4bb30e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#606160 is the less saturated color, while #49ba07 is the most saturated one.
